0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

西门子PLC S7-1200/1500与精简面板仿真详细图解

dytfki8u8yql 来源:电子技术控 作者:电子技术控 2022-11-30 14:40 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

S7-1200/S7-1500与精简面板仿真有两个需要注意的问题

1)、S7-1200 的CPU的固件版本应为V4.0或更高版本。S7-1200 只能用S7-PLCSIM V13 SP1或更高的版本仿真。

2)、博途中和STEP 7 V5.5中的S7-300/S7-400的仿真软件S7-PLCSIM V5.4的使用方法完全相同。S7-1200/S7-1500的仿真软件S7-PLCSIM V13可以作为独立的软件单独打开,其使用方法与S7-PLCSIM V5.4有较大的区别,它仿真时需要独立于博途项目的仿真项目。

下面是仿真过程的步骤和图解

打开博途的项目视图,单击工具栏最左边的“新建项目”按钮,创建一个新项目。

双击项目树中的“添加新设备”,选中“添加新设备”对话框中的V4.1版的CPU 1214C AC/DC/Rly, 其PN接口的IP地址为192.168.0.1,子网掩码为255.255.255.0。单击“确定”按钮确认。

c263035c-706b-11ed-8abf-dac502259ad0.jpg

双击项目树中的“添加新设备”,选中“添加新设备”对话框中的KTP400 Basic精简面板,不要勾选“启用设备向导”复选框。单击“确定”按钮确认。

c28bd75a-706b-11ed-8abf-dac502259ad0.jpg

双击项目视图中的“设备和网络”,打开网络视图。单击“连接”按钮,自动选中“HMI连接”。用拖拽的方法连接HMI和PLC的PN接口,自动生成HMI_连接_1。

c2ad59c0-706b-11ed-8abf-dac502259ad0.jpg

S7-1500和V4.0及更高版本的S7-1200应选中设备视图中的CPU,再选中巡视视图中的“属性 》 常规 》 保护”,采用默认的设置,右边窗口的复选框“允许从远程伙伴(PLC、HMI、OPC、。.)使用PUT/GET通信访问”被自动选中。

在PLC的默认变量表中生成BOOL变量“起动按钮”M0.0和“停止按钮”M0.1,它们的信号来自HMI画面上的按钮,用画面上的指示灯显示变量“电动机”Q0.0的状态。

下面是PLC主程序中的梯形图

c2bd5d48-706b-11ed-8abf-dac502259ad0.jpg

在Windows 7的控制面板中执行菜单命令“查看”→“转至”→“所有控制面板项”,显示所有的控制面板项。双击其中的“设置PG/PC接口”,打开“设置PG/PC接口”对话框。单击“为使用的接口分配参数”列表框中的“PLCSIM S7-1200/S7-1500.TCPIP.1”,设置“应用程序访问点”为“S7ONLINE (STEP 7) --》PLCSIM S7-1200/S7-1500.TCPIP.1”。最后单击“确定”按钮确认。

c2d62ddc-706b-11ed-8abf-dac502259ad0.jpg

单击“警告”对话框中的“确定”按钮。关闭控制面板。

c2f7d392-706b-11ed-8abf-dac502259ad0.jpg

为了验证仿真是否成功,在启动画面中组态一个指示灯和两个按钮,按钮组态为点动按钮,按下时将变量置位,释放时将变量复位。用PLC程序中的起保停电路和画面上的按钮控制指示灯。

选中项目树中的PLC_1站点,执行菜单命令“在线”→“仿真”→“启动”,打开S7-1200/S7-1500的仿真软件S7-PLCSIM V13的精简视图,自动生成一个S7-PLCSIM V13的项目。

c3107e1a-706b-11ed-8abf-dac502259ad0.jpg

同时出现“扩展的下载到设备”对话框。按下图设置好“PG/PC接口的类型”“PG/PC接口”和“接口/子网的连接”,使用CPU的PN接口下载程序。

单击“开始搜索”按钮,“目标子网中的兼容设备”列表中显示出搜索到的仿真CPU的以太网接口的IP地址。

c32c55e0-706b-11ed-8abf-dac502259ad0.jpg

单击“下载”按钮,出现“下载预览”对话框,勾选复选框“全部覆盖”,编译成功后,单击“下载”按钮,将程序下载到PLC。

c32c55e0-706b-11ed-8abf-dac502259ad0.jpg

勾选“全部启动”复选框,单击“完成”按钮。

c3802dbe-706b-11ed-8abf-dac502259ad0.jpg

下载成功后,PLCSIM的CPU自动切换到RUN模式。

c3a6df90-706b-11ed-8abf-dac502259ad0.jpg

选中博途中的HMI_1站点,执行菜单命令“在线”→“仿真”→“启动”,或单击工具栏上的“开始仿真”按钮,起动HMI运行系统仿真器。编译成功后,出现仿真面板和根画面。

单击 “起动”按钮,变量“起动按钮”(M0.0)被置为1状态,由于PLC中的梯形图程序的作用,变量“电动机”(Q0.0)变为1状态又变为0状态,画面上的指示灯亮。单击画面中的“停止”按钮,变量“停止按钮”(M0.1)变为1状态后又变为0状态,指示灯熄灭。

c3bd2296-706b-11ed-8abf-dac502259ad0.jpg

审核编辑 :李倩

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• plc
    plc
    +关注

    关注

    5045

    文章

    14450

    浏览量

    483668
  • 仿真
    +关注

    关注

    53

    文章

    4411

    浏览量

    137679
  • S7-1200
    +关注

    关注

    11

    文章

    334

    浏览量

    19235

原文标题:西门子PLC S7-1200/1500与精简面板仿真详细图解

文章出处:【微信号:电子技术控,微信公众号:电子技术控】欢迎添加关注!文章转载请注明出处。

收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    西门子S7-1500 PLCS7-300 PLC Profibus-DP通讯的组态实例

    本文就以改造一套以西门子S7-300 317-2DP PLC(6ES7 317-2AJ10-0AB0 V2.1)为控制核心的电气控制系统为例,介绍使用
    的头像 发表于 11-25 14:27 671次阅读
    <b class='flag-5'>西门子</b><b class='flag-5'>S7-1500</b> <b class='flag-5'>PLC</b>和<b class='flag-5'>S7</b>-300 <b class='flag-5'>PLC</b> Profibus-DP通讯的组态实例

    稳联技术Profinet嵌入式开发板与西门子PLC S7-1200

    本案例以集成PROFINET从站通讯协议的OEM通讯模块,及西门子S7-1200 PLC作为PROFINET主站为例,进行关于PROFINET通讯模块的通讯测试。 西门子
    的头像 发表于 11-03 17:06 512次阅读
    稳联技术Profinet嵌入式开发板与<b class='flag-5'>西门子</b><b class='flag-5'>PLC</b> <b class='flag-5'>S7-1200</b>

    HINET网关实现西门子S7-1200 PLC远程监控方案

    、触摸屏等工业设备建立稳定连接。该产品采用开放的数据通信协议,配置流程简洁明了,能够有效实现PLC设备在移动终端与平台层面的数据在线监控。 西门子S7-1200基于华辰智通HINET网关的远程监控方案: 现场设备组网:将华辰智通
    的头像 发表于 10-29 16:18 384次阅读

    天拓四方分享:什么事S7-1200 G2++?

    中国市场动态,致力于满足广大用户的多样化需求。基于此,西门子S7-1200 G2 的基础上,精心打造了增强型 PLC——S7-1200 G2++。此次推出的型号包含
    的头像 发表于 09-05 17:17 965次阅读

    基于Modbus TCP的WinCC监控S7-1200/200SMT应用实例

    测试设备与参数 l 西门子PLC型号:S7-1200 × 1台 l 西门子PLC型号:S7-20
    的头像 发表于 08-12 09:15 736次阅读
    基于Modbus TCP的WinCC监控<b class='flag-5'>S7-1200</b>/200SMT应用实例

    RS232转Profinet网关与西门子S7-1200 PLC的智能化工业通信应用

    在工业自动化领域,设备间的通信如同人体的神经系统,需要精准、高效的信号传递。将密度传感器这类传统设备接入现代工业网络时,RS232转Profinet网关扮演着“翻译官”的角色,而西门子S7-1200 PLC则如同系统的“大脑”,
    的头像 发表于 08-02 21:14 1332次阅读

    RS232转Profinet网关实现伟斯扫码枪A898BT与西门子S7-1200 PLC的快速通讯

    在工业自动化领域,实现设备间的高效通信是提升生产线智能化水平的关键。本文将详细介绍如何通过RS232转Profinet网关,将台湾伟斯(A898BT)扫码枪接入西门子S7-1200 PLC
    的头像 发表于 08-02 20:48 1402次阅读

    MPI 转以太网模块案例:西门子 S7-300PLC 借此与 S7-1200、触摸屏及 ModbusRTU 变频器通讯

    一、项目背景与痛点 在新能源储能系统集成场景中,某锂电池生产线采用西门子S7-300PLC作为本地控制器,通过MPI/DP接口连接西门子TP1200Comfort触摸屏实现本地操作。随
    的头像 发表于 07-30 10:02 552次阅读
    MPI 转以太网模块案例:<b class='flag-5'>西门子</b> <b class='flag-5'>S7-300PLC</b> 借此与 <b class='flag-5'>S7-1200</b>、触摸屏及 ModbusRTU 变频器通讯

    西门子PLC免点表数据采集方案

    西门子PLC S7-1200S7-1500S7-300/400型号设备,常用协议:PPI(Process Communication I
    的头像 发表于 07-04 11:26 507次阅读
    <b class='flag-5'>西门子</b><b class='flag-5'>PLC</b>免点表数据采集方案

    西门子PLCS7-1200/1500/300/400)的数据采集与监控方案

    西门子PLC S7-1200S7-1500S7-300/400型号设备,常用协议:PPI(Process Communication I
    的头像 发表于 07-04 10:13 985次阅读

    西门子S7-1200 G2的7大亮点及最新功能

    西门子S7-1200 G2是新发布的新一代可编程逻辑控制器(PLC),作为S7-1200系列的升级版,它在硬件设计、性能、运动控制、通信能力和安全功能等方面进行了显著改进,适用于中小型
    的头像 发表于 07-03 17:04 2486次阅读
     <b class='flag-5'>西门子</b><b class='flag-5'>S7-1200</b> G2的<b class='flag-5'>7</b>大亮点及最新功能

    CANopen转PROFINET网关:西门子S7-1200 PLC与欧姆龙NJ系列PLC通信方案

    进行通信,而另一部分则依赖 CANopen协议 。为实现不同协议设备之间的无缝通信与协同工作,引入高效可靠的 协议转换网关 成为当务之急。 二、设备选型 1. ROFINET协议主站PLC :选用西门子S7-1500系列
    的头像 发表于 06-12 15:25 549次阅读
    CANopen转PROFINET网关:<b class='flag-5'>西门子</b><b class='flag-5'>S7-1200</b> <b class='flag-5'>PLC</b>与欧姆龙NJ系列<b class='flag-5'>PLC</b>通信方案

    西门子S7 PLC通过深控技术无点表工业网关实现数据采集与智能决策方案

    深控技术“不需要点表的工业数采网关”针对西门子S7系列PLC(包括S7-300、S7-400、S7-12
    的头像 发表于 05-23 10:44 566次阅读

    EtherCAT转ProfiNet西门子1200PLC与伺服电机通讯案例全解

    的其它设备或连接到ProfiNetPLC上,并在正常运行中支持EtherCAT协议。本产品可作为EtherCAT主站,做为西门子S7-1200系列PLC的从站并在监控系统中支持 PROFINET 协议
    的头像 发表于 03-21 09:42 1401次阅读
    EtherCAT转ProfiNet<b class='flag-5'>西门子</b><b class='flag-5'>1200PLC</b>与伺服电机通讯案例全解

    工业智能网关采集西门子PLC的智能工厂解决方案

    场景描述: 某智能工厂的自动化生产线上,使用了西门子S7-1200 PLC来控制生产设备,并通过西门子S7-400实现车间环境的智控;同时部
    的头像 发表于 01-20 17:30 1010次阅读
    工业智能网关采集<b class='flag-5'>西门子</b><b class='flag-5'>PLC</b>的智能工厂解决方案